Which historical figure should be portrayed on the big screen?

Whose biopic would you like to see? And who would play them?

This year's Golden Globe Awards have been dominated by biographical pictures.

While Forest Whitaker won Best Actor (Film, Drama) for his role as Idi Amin in the Last King of Scotland, the night belonged to Dame Helen Mirren who won Best Actress for both Film and Television for her portrayal of Elizabeth II (in The Queen) and Elizabeth I, respectively.

Which figure from history or public life would you most want to see a movie about? What did you think of the films that won and lost at the Golden Globes?😕
